Liz Claiborne Inc. acquired Lucky Brand Jeans in May 1999. In 2005, the company expanded its line to include clothing for infants through age 10. In 2006, the company opened Lucky Brand Jeans Kid stores, which exclusively sell their children's clothing.

History

In the 1970s, 21-year-old Gene Montesano and 17-year-old Barry Perlman opened a Florida jeans shop called Four Way Street. "During the evenings, we'd head out to the local Laundromat with our pockets full of coins and some bleach. A few hours later, we had a stack of great washed jeans -- one of a kind and 100% authentic!” This is where the foundation that would become Lucky Brand Jeans was started.

In 1978, Gene moved to enter into the Los Angeles fashion industry. With partner Michael Caruso he started Bongo and ran the brand for 15 years. After leaving Bongo, Gene teamed up with his old business partner Barry Perlman in 1990 to launch Lucky Brand.

Gene & Barry created a brand that is known for the attention to detail put into each pair of jeans. This along with the stitching of "Lucky You" on the fly, accomplishes the goal that Gene & Barry set out to do; to create a product of good quality & good humor.

Lucky Foundation

The Lucky Brand Foundation was launched in 1996, which was established with a goal to help children first. Since the launch the foundation has raised over $8 million through fund raising events. Such events have featured rock performers such as Jackson Browne, Joe Cocker, B.B. King, and Bonnie Raitt. Another way the Foundation has been consistently successful at accomplishing their set goal is through the annual Black Tie & Blue Jeans Gala, which has a record of raising approximately $6 million for numerous children's charities including: Smile Train, Camp Sundown, Island Dolphin Care, Shane's Inspiration and The Bridge School. With the celebration of the 40th anniversary of the Summer of Love and the Beatles' Sgt. Pepper's album, Lucky Foundation was able to raise more than $700,000.

Product

All of the products sold by Lucky as well as their stores' decoration reflects a bohemian style. Denim is the major selling point of the company, making up about 60% of business. All Lucky Brand Jeans have two four-leaf clovers, and the phrase "LUCKY ME!" and "LUCKY YOU!" stitched onto the inside and outside of the fly shield respectively. This has become a trademark of their denim line. Their denim line is made up of a wide variety of fits and a wide variety of washing.

Lucky products are manufactured in the USA (before 2010), Indonesia, China, Peru, Chile, Vietnam, Mexico and Sri Lanka. All USA-manufactured Lucky jeans are made in Vernon, near downtown Los Angeles. In addition, the jeans manufactured in the United States are all hand-made, and all the detailing is done by hand, except for the actual washing process.

Style of Jeans for Women

Charlie (Skinny, Baby Boot, Flare), Zoe (Straight, Bootleg), Lola (Skinny, Bootleg), Riley Boyfriend, Sweet 'n' Low, Sweet N' Straight, Classic Rider (select stores), Sofia Boot and Sienna Tomboy. Easy Rider and Lil Maggie available online only.

Style of Jeans for Men

Heritage Slim, Original Straight (formerly Slim Straight), Original Boot (formerly Slim Bootleg), Vintage Straight, Relaxed Bootleg, 181 Jean, 101 Super Slim.
